A read operation is performed in two stages. A data write is used to set the register address, then a data read is
performed to retrieve the data from the set address. A read burst operation is also supported. This is shown in
Figure 10.

AC and DC electrical specifications for the SCL and SDA pins are shown in Table 7. The timing specifications and
timing diagram for the I
2
C bus is compatible with the I
2
C-Bus Standard. SDA timeout is supported for compatibility
with SMBus interfaces.
